halite
noun/ˈheɪlaɪt/
Frequency rank: #19,858 most common English word
Meaning
A naturally occurring mineral form of sodium chloride; rock salt.

Example sentence
The geologist collected halite crystals from the ancient salt flat to study their formation.
Synonyms & related words
- salt
- rocksalt
